Berberine Side Effects: GI Issues & Drug Interactions
Real, dose-related GI side effects (diarrhea, cramping, constipation), especially early — and drug interactions that matter more than the GI upset. Who should not take it.
Berberine vs Metformin (2026): The Honest Comparison
How berberine compares to metformin on the evidence, and why it isn't a replacement — one small trial found comparable glucose control, but metformin carries decades of outcome data berberine doesn't.
